Maintenance Myths Debunked
Contrary to what YouTubers might say, modern solar battery systems aren't high-maintenance divas. Our sealed units require just annual dusting and quarterly software updates. The real maintenance hack? Using your system daily - lithium batteries actually prefer regular shallow discharges over sitting idle.

The Backup Power Paradox
Here's something most installers won't tell you: Battery capacity ≠ available power. A 10kWh battery might only deliver 9kWh usable energy after accounting for conversion losses and safety margins.
